John Therien is an integral part of the leadership of Smith Anderson's Chambers Global-rated AgTech industry group and advises a broad range of clients in commercial transactions involving intellectual property, including domestic and international corporate partnering, patent and technology licensing, research and development collaborations, joint ventures, mergers and acquisitions, supply chain, distribution, and co-promotion arrangements, and other strategic commercial transactions. In Chambers USA clients describe John as "extremely smart, responsive and hard-working." He has extensive experience advising companies in the agricultural biotechnology and pharmaceutical industries and also frequently counsels clients in the diagnostics, medical device, software, video game, and technology sectors on transactional matters. Prior to joining Smith Anderson, John practiced at a prominent global law firm in Boston.
Career
Since 2004: Smith Anderson. 2002-2004: Ropes & Gray, LLP, Boston, MA. 2001-2002: Law Clerk to Chief Justice Margaret H. Marshall, Massachusetts Supreme Judicial Court.
Personal
J.D., U.C. Berkeley School of Law (Order of the Coif). A.B., biochemical sciences, Harvard College (magna cum laude).
